Dave Chinner wrote: > The swap extent ioctl passes in a target inode and a temporary > inode which are clearly named in the ioctl structure. The code > then assigns temp to target and vice versa, making it extremely > difficult to work out which inode is which later in the code. > Make this consistent throughout the code. > > Also make xfs_swap_extent static as there are no external users > of the function.
